Time 4 Learning Charter School

5900 S 51st St
Greendale, WI 53129
Time 4 Learning Charter School serves 91 students in grades Prekindergarten. 
The student:teacher ratio of 30:1 is higher than the Wisconsin state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 27%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Wisconsin state average of 33% (majority Hispanic).

School Overview

Time 4 Learning Charter School's student population of 91 students has declined by 19% over five school years.
The teacher population of 3 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
